Model no: 3: The outline of the project is selection of supply from mains, generator, and inverter and solar automatically by using microcontroller concept. As it is not feasible to provide all 4 different sources of supply, one source with alternate switches are provided to get the same function. In this project we are having 4 switches which we consider as 4 different source of supply. When we press any of the switches it shows the absence of that particular source which is connected to microcontroller as input signals. Here we are using 8051 family microcontroller. The output of microcontroller is given to the ULN2003 this acts as a relay driver. This can drive up to 7 relays. The relays which are used hear are 12V relay. The output can be observed using lamp which is getting uninterrupted power supply from other means if main supply is cut off. The power supply consists of a step down transformer 230/12V, which steps down the voltage to 12V AC. This is converted to DC using a Bridge rectifier. The ripples are removed using a capacitive filter and it is then regulated to +5V using a voltage regulator 7805 which is required for the operation of the microcontroller and other components.

Model no: 8: The project is taken up for a three phase solid state relay that incorporates three single phase units. Each phase is controlled individually by a power TRIAC with optional snubber network (RS, CS) and an optically isolated TRIAC driver with current limit by a constant current arrangement. All LEDs are connected in series and can be controlled by one logic gate or controller. One microcontroller is used to generate output pulses after zero voltage pulse to verify as to whether the load is getting the switched on at zero cross of the supply wave form or not. The zero crossing feature of the TRIAC driver, (an opto-isolator) ensures lower generated noise avoiding sudden inrush currents on resistive loads and moderate inductive loads. Here in this project we are using two push buttons which are used as up down buttons which are used for increasing the speed of the AC motor. This buttons are given to microcontroller as inputs. On the base of input signal from push button the MOC3063 is used as a switching element this is the opto-isolator is zero crossing switching element. On the base of this switching element TRIAC will be triggered.

Model no: 14A: The main motto of the project is to operate the curtain raiser to open and close with a swing motor Wireless technology. In this project thesis, we are pressing a button from a TV remote which acts a transmitter and send signal to and it is received by IR receiver, the output signal from receiver is fed to a programmable microcontroller from 8051 family, is engaged to actuate the Swing Motor to rotate in forward and reverse direction indicating the curtain raiser open /close with help of relays which is driven by an IC ULN2003 (relay driver). The power supply consists of a step down transformer 230/12V, which steps down the voltage to 12V AC. This is converted to DC using a Bridge rectifier and it is then regulated to +5V using a voltage regulator 7805 which is required for the operation of the microcontroller and other components.

Model no:7 : Incandescent lamps exhibit very low resistance in cold condition. Thus at the time of switching from cold state it draws very high current. Thus many lamps fail at the time of switch ON. Engaging two SCRs in anti parallel or a TRIAC the switching ON time can be precisely controlled by firing after detecting the zero cross point of the waveform of supply voltage. This should result in current waveform rising from zero at the time of switching ON there by increasing the life of lamp. The project is having comparator which is used for ZVS output. The ZVS (ZERO VOLTAGE START) is given as reference interrupt to microcontroller. The microcontroller is of 8051 family which is of 8bit. In this we are using push button as switch which is used as reference interrupt to microcontroller and using that interrupt we give signal to opto-isolator. The opto-isolator used in the project is used as switching element using this we will trigger the back to back SCR. On the base of SCR triggering the AC lamp can be controlled to ON at low voltage. The power supply consists of a step down transformer 230/12V, which steps down the voltage to 12V AC. This is converted to DC using a Bridge rectifier. The ripples are removed using a capacitive filter and it is then regulated to +5V using a voltage regulator 7805 which is required for the operation of the microcontroller and other components.

Model no. 42: AC motors have a great advantage of being relatively inexpensive and very reliable. Induction motors in particular are very robust and therefore used in many domestic appliances such as washing machines, vacuum cleaners, water pumps, and others. The induction motor may be regarded as practically a constant-speed machine, the difficulty of varying its speed economically constitutes one of its main disadvantages. This drawback is overcome by using thyristor controlled cycloconverter that enables the speed to be lowered in steps by Microcontroller triggering a SCR bank of 8nos in F, F/2 & F/3 duly interfaced through opto-isolators. A pair of switches is used to input logical signal for the desired output. The power supply consists of a step down transformer 230/12V, which steps down the voltage to 12V AC. This is converted to DC using a Bridge rectifier. The ripples are removed using a capacitive filter and it is then regulated to +5V using a voltage regulator 7805 which is required for the operation of the microcontroller and other components.

This video shows my implementation of Pong on an ATmega1280 dev board (AVR 51 microcontroller). The game uses the accelerometer of the respective Wii mote to calculate the racket position of player 1 or 2. To communicate with the Wii motes, it uses a bluetooth module. Furthermore a bundled MP3 and SD-card module is used to play sounds from unreal tournament (stored on the SD-card), each time a player scores a point. This game was an exercise of the microcontroller course at TU Vienna in 2012S.

As a part of a project funded by the Government of Republic of Srpska, we, at the Faculty of Electrical Engineering, Department of Electronics, have developed a microcontroller system for wheelchair control by head movements. This kind of interface is intended to grant quadriplegics a level of autonomous motion, by allowing them to control their wheelchair by head movements. We are using inertial sensors to track head motion, thus enabling the MCU to translate the motion into wheelchair commands. The MCU is running an algorithm developed through our project. Motion recognition is much simpler than DTW, HMM and AI methods. More details will be added later. Contact: aleksandar.pajkanovic [ at ] etfbl.net

Bloom is a serial port to TCP/IP socket redirector for Microsoft Windows. It can be used to map a serial device, such as an Arduino microcontroller or a Shimmer wearable health sensor, to a TCP/IP port, thus network-enabling the device. In this video, we demonstrate how to use Bloom to control a simple Flash game running in a web-browser using an Arduino, a potentiometer, and a digital push button. Progressing with the DIY GOTO controller for the homemade telescope mount. Here we can see the worm starting off at sidereal speed, and then being moved at various speeds back and forth. Still a bit jerky at the start of the speed change, but getting there. The system consists of a Maxon motor + 512cpr encoder and 30:1 gearbox controlled by an Arduino Mega microcontroller. An Avago counter IC is used to keep track of the encoder. Trying to measure a 512cpr encoder on a motor running at 5000rpm is a job for a dedicated counter IC and should not be tried with interrupts on an Arduino.
